That extra bit of texture turns us all into a bit of a Jamie Oliver. After being around for how ever many years, the penny has dropped for Subway and they’ve made it so you can create your own ‘crisp sub.
You’ll be able to add Walkers Ready Salted Crisps to your Subway sandwich in the most nostalgic way ever. In store you can add crisps as well as 53 other ingredients to you 6-inch of footlong sub when ordering from the 23rd of May.



Angelina Gosal, Head of Marketing UK & Ireland at Subway said: “The crisp sandwich is an iconic and important part of Britain’s culinary traditions and we’re excited to partner with Walkers to allow guests to now order one in store.



“With the addition of Walkers crisps to the toppings you can add to our Subs, we have one of the biggest, tastiest and the crunchiest menus on the high street!”
Fernando Kahane, Marketing Director at Walkers commented: “As a nation, we may not agree on everything, but we are united in the fact that a lunchtime sandwich without crisps is just not the same.”
We have all pretty much decided what our favourite subway is by now, so it will just be a case of adding crisps for an extra 20p, easy.
